"""Tests for Automation Blueprints — the parameterized automation blueprint system.

Covers the core catalog/slot schema/renderers/fill (cron/blueprint_catalog.py),
the shared /blueprint command handler (hermes_cli/blueprint_cmd.py), and
the docs generator. Uses an isolated HERMES_HOME for anything that touches the
cron job store.
"""

    def test_hydration_hourly_step_actually_fires_at_chosen_cadence(self):
        # Regression: a minute-field step (*/90) silently wraps to hourly.
        # The hour-field step form must produce the cadence the user picked.
        croniter = pytest.importorskip("croniter").croniter
        from datetime import datetime

        spec = fill_blueprint(get_blueprint("hydration-move"), {"interval_hours": "2"})
        it = croniter(spec["schedule"], datetime(2026, 6, 10, 8, 0))
        first_three = [it.get_next(datetime) for _ in range(3)]
        gaps = {
            (b - a).total_seconds()
            for a, b in zip(first_three, first_three[1:])
        }
        assert gaps == {7200.0}, f"expected 2h gaps, got {spec['schedule']} -> {first_three}"
